World-Class Ukulhas Island House Reef Snorkeling

You don’t need an expensive boat charter to explore world-class marine life here. The famous Ukulhas house reef lies just a short swim from the shore, opening up a bustling coral garden accessible to swimmers of all experience levels.

Slip on your mask and fins to glide over vibrant coral formations teeming with life. Within minutes of leaving the beach, you’ll find yourself drifting alongside hawksbill sea turtles, gentle reef sharks, and graceful eagle rays. The sheer variety of species right off the sand makes Ukulhas one of the top shore-accessible snorkeling destinations in the Maldives.

Authentic Maldivian Hospitality and Eco-Living

What truly sets Ukulhas apart from other local islands is its deep community commitment to environmental sustainability. Recognized as a pioneer in local eco-tourism, Ukulhas was the first island in the archipelago to implement a comprehensive, island-wide waste management system, keeping its streets and shores impeccably clean.

Wandering through the peaceful village, you will encounter genuine local warmth. Charming open-air cafes serve up a mix of international favorites and authentic Maldivian dishes, such as Mas Huni—a delicious blend of shredded tuna, fresh coconut, lime, and chili paired with warm flatbread.

Travel Logistics: Male to Ukulhas Speedboat Transfer

Reaching your island paradise is straightforward and stress-free:

  • Location: North Ari Atoll, roughly 72 kilometers west of Malé.
  • Speedboat Transfer: Daily scheduled speedboats run directly from Velana International Airport (MLE) to Ukulhas, taking approximately 90 minutes each way.
  • Best Time to Visit: The dry season runs from November to April, offering peak sunshine, calm seas, and crystal-clear underwater visibility.
